Transaction 515efe5efaac2d53d53dbfcce85d636f0790e1567757cdbc8a0d49faa61c2bd4
1 Input
1 Output
-
515efe5efaac2d53d53dbfcce85d636f0790e1567757cdbc8a0d49faa61c2bd4:0
- value
- 1686907
- script pubkey
- OP_0 OP_PUSHBYTES_20 514a72ab3f251c0256428942e6508a3e96a6a17e
- address
- bc1q299892ely5wqy4jz39pwv5y286t2dgt7rmrqag